Output dddda62238feef9d40ed08d56cb4ae1b154750de6a695000b80c9fb67b354b46:32

value
46146
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5910208951360e1e86e53bb1257914c1fc989de3428c9c2eb32ac3162563bf24
address
bc1ptygzpz23xc8paph98wcj27g5c87f380rg2xfct4n9tp3vftrhujqxu89uh
transaction
dddda62238feef9d40ed08d56cb4ae1b154750de6a695000b80c9fb67b354b46
confirmations
107548
spent
true